You are viewing a single comment's thread from:
RE: Achieving Human Hibernation: [Suspended Animation In-view]
I really cant say where science is leading us to. But hope it won't make people loose faith in God
I really cant say where science is leading us to. But hope it won't make people loose faith in God
Lol. Science is quite different from religion